Where You’ll Make a Difference

  • Ensure global Six Sigma raw material availability to meet 98% on-time customer delivery through operational buying, vendor management, and process improvement.
  • Manage daily demand from six manufacturing plants in Georgia, including purchasing, stock replenishment, and monitoring inbound deliveries.
  • Resolve raw material shortages promptly to maintain production continuity.
  • Collaborate with local supply chain planners and site managers to align day-to-day planning processes.
  • Partner with procurement and vendors to enhance delivery schedules and implement mutual process improvements.
  • Optimize raw material availability and global inventory metrics, including inventory days, write-offs, and management of obsolete or slow-moving stock.
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ives to strengthen supply chain efficiency and reduce operational risks.
  • Act as the accountable representative for Taste raw material planning in cross-functional projects.
  • Monitor and report KPIs related to material availability, vendor performance, and inventory health.

What Makes You the Right Fit

  • Bachelor’s deg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, Operations Management, or a related discipline.
  • Minimum 4 years of experience in planning and/or operational buying within a supply chain environment.
  • Strong understanding of MRP systems and related applications for managing demand, supply, and material flow (e.g., SAP MRP).
  • Proven ability to manage expectations and collaborate effectively in an international environment with geographically dispersed stakeholders across multiple functions.
  • Excellent communication skills with fluency in English, both written and spoken.
